Meet the Artists

Jojo Hynes and Jennifer Cunningham


Lead artist Jojo and artist Jennifer, produced workshops and created resources for the 5 Virtually Here primary schools funded by Galway 2020.

Jojo Hynes

Hi, my name is Jojo Hynes and I'm from Creevaghbawn outside Tuam.

I work as a Visual, Digital and Collaborative Artist.

I use film, sound, VR and Fine art to create my art pieces.

My artworks often explore the themes of local/place, myths and legends.

I've lived in Melbourne and London and studied Art at University.

I have collaborated with many different artists, young artists, schools and groups.

I love learning new skills and creating art.

Jennifer Cunningham

Hi, My name is Jennifer Cunningham and I live in Tuam, Co Galway.

I use paint, etch plates, make models, shoot and edit sound and film to create my artwork. I’ve studied art at University and have had many exhibitions over the years. I was recently asked to design the poster for the Galway International Arts Festival.

My artworks explore the theme of nostaglia and I often use my own memories as a starting point, looking at how a child's imagination is a place of freedom and play and a safe place to explore the world around them.
